Grilled chicken with mole black beans

If you are keeping to a mind diet, ensure you consume beans about four times weekly. The ingredients you will need to cook the grilled chicken with mole black beans are easy to get. They include ancho chile powder, kosher salt, chicken thighs, scallions, olive oil, onion, garlic, cumin, cinnamon, black beans, bittersweet chocolate, instant espresso, red wine vinegar, radishes, fresh cilantro, and cooking spray.

Chicken is a common meal for many, of course. Making it to go with your beans is a great way to give your brain the boost it deserves with rich sources of protein.

Hazelnut-crusted halibut with beet and spinach salad

This one offers a great opportunity to get 5 servings of nuts per week. This is an important part of the mind diet. Preparing the hazelnut-crusted halibut with beet and spinach salad is easy and takes between 20 – 30 minutes of your time.
